Understanding car insurance can feel overwhelming, especially when it comes to terms like “extensive” and “crash” coverage. Choosing the right coverage is essential to protect your vehicle, your finances, and your peace of mind. Here’s a simple breakdown to help you make an informed decision.

1. What Is Extensive Coverage?
Extensive coverage, sometimes called “comprehensive coverage,” protects your car from damage that isn’t caused by a collision. This includes incidents like theft, fire, vandalism, natural disasters, or falling objects. Extensive coverage is ideal for drivers who want to safeguard their vehicle against unexpected events beyond accidents.

2. What Is Crash Coverage?
Crash coverage, often referred to as “collision coverage,” protects your car when it’s damaged in an accident—whether it’s with another vehicle or an object like a tree or guardrail. This type of coverage helps pay for repairs or replacement of your car regardless of who is at fault, providing financial relief in case of a collision.

3. Key Differences Between Extensive and Crash Coverage
The main difference lies in the type of risk each covers. Extensive coverage handles non-collision-related damage, while crash coverage focuses solely on accidents. Many drivers combine both to ensure full protection for their vehicle, giving peace of mind no matter what happens on the road.

4. Why Both May Be Important
While crash coverage is essential for accidents, extensive coverage protects against events outside your control, like natural disasters or theft. Together, they provide comprehensive protection, helping you avoid large out-of-pocket expenses and ensuring your car can be repaired or replaced when needed.

5. Consider Your Vehicle and Lifestyle
The type of coverage you choose should reflect your vehicle’s value, driving habits, and risk tolerance. Older cars may not need full extensive coverage if the repair costs exceed the vehicle’s value, while newer or high-value cars benefit greatly from both extensive and crash coverage.
